1988 Volkswagen Jetta Carat review from North America

"Definitely worth it!"

What things have gone wrong with the car?

First thing to go was oil sensor, it would go off after a few minutes of driving. An easy fix.

I was working on my car at a buddy's house when we noticed antifreeze leaking on the driveway. Got new coolant sensor and cap.

The car had been sitting for a year before I bought it, so I took it in for normal maintenance (brake check, fluids, engine check, had to replace valve cover gasket, had to replace a cv joint and an exhaust downpipe, not cheap, but routine stuff for an 88.)

Relocated from Vancouver to Calgary, car made the trip (1000k+) pretty easily, but as of now needs:

master brake cylinder (brakes very light),ebrake retightened, block heater, idle fixed.

General comments?

All in all, this is a great little car for my first one. The engine as rebuilt 6 months before I bought it, so I'll never really have to worry about it. The interior is great (those krauts know how to make their cars, practical, but still roomy enough for four people) and the 1.8 engine is great for acceleration and highway driving.

My only complaints are that my car is a 3 speed automatic (sounds like a giant mosquito on the freeway doing 140km at 4.5k rpm in 3rd). I wish my car was a standard, better control on Calgary roads, not to mention the whole 3 speed thing, my kingdom for another gear at least)

One thing that I was hoping to get some help on though was my idle. it used to idle very low (and sometimes stall at intersections and stop signs if I didn't keep my foot on the gas all the time. I had it fixed (changed both fuel pumps etc), but after a few road trips it's doing the same thing again. it's never stalled on the freeway or anything like that, just at stops or really low speeds. Shoddy electronics maybe? Any help would be appreciated. Thanks.
